The death toll from devastating flash floods along the Nepal-China border has risen to over 800, with 788 fatalities reported in Nepal and 16 in Tibet.
More than 3,000 individuals, including hundreds of foreign nationals, remain missing.

Impact & Risks

The floods have caused widespread devastation, with significant loss of life and displacement of thousands. The newly formed lake in Tibet could lead to another surge of water, exacerbating the situation. Landslides have blocked key transport routes, including a major highway between Kathmandu and southern Nepal, raising concerns about supply shortages and hindering aid delivery. Hydropower projects in Nepal have been severely impacted, with hundreds of workers missing.
